
2019 Educational Conference – CLEAR
The Council on Licensure, Enforcement & Regulation will host its 2019 educational conference from September 18 to 21 in Minneapolis.
WeirFoulds lawyers, Jill Dougherty, Ada Keon and Lara Kinkartz, will speak at the event. Ada and Jill will participate as moderator and speaker, respectively, in the session, “Too Much Information! The Use of a Professional’s Social Media History in Registration, Investigations, and Professional Misconduct Prosecutions”. Lara will speak about “Rare Events with Catastrophic Impacts: Lessons from Cases Involving Intentional Harm to Patients” and also moderate a panel on “The Enforcement Workload Calculator”.
Partner Debbie Tarshis will also be in attendance.
The Annual Educational Conference is attended by more than 600 members of the regulatory community from across North America, Europe, Australia and New Zealand. Conference content is developed by and for members of the regulatory community and focuses on four areas of inquiry:
- Compliance and discipline
- Testing and examination issues
- Entry to practice issues
- Administration, legislation and policy
